Attachment
A deep and enduring emotional bond that connects one person to another across time and space, often discussed in the context of relationships between infants and caregivers.
Attachment Theory
A psychological, evolutionary, and ethological theory concerning relationships between humans, primarily the bond between infants and their caregivers, influencing future social and emotional development.
Patterns of Relationships
Recurring dynamics and behaviors observed within interpersonal relationships, which can influence the nature of social connections and interactions.
Environmental Origins
The concept that one's surroundings and context can significantly influence their development, traits, and behaviors.
